In this article, we will review various innovative patterns reflected in the fields of interdisciplinary education, illustrating how these approaches contribute to enhancing students’ understanding and knowledge. ## Concept of Interdisciplinary Education
Interdisciplinary education means integrating knowledge, methods, and different fields of study to solve complex problems. This type of education transcends the traditional boundaries of academic disciplines and is based on the idea that understanding global issues requires a holistic approach that combines social sciences, environmental sciences, mathematics, arts, and more. Through this approach, students can see the relationships between various fields of knowledge, enhancing their ability to think comprehensively.
## Curriculum Integration Strategies
Curriculum integration strategies include several methods, such as project-based learning, where students work on real tasks that require them to use multiple skills in problem solving. There are also hands-on workshops that encourage students to actively participate in diverse educational activities. Furthermore, learning based on multiple information sources is another integration method, where videos, lectures, and literature are utilized, contributing to enhancing learning experiences and expanding knowledge.

## Challenges Facing Interdisciplinary Education
Despite its advantages, interdisciplinary education faces a range of challenges. One of these challenges is the lack of competencies among some teachers to effectively implement these curricula. Teachers may need specific training to empower them to design lessons that integrate different fields. Moreover, time constraints and traditional curricula focused on specific disciplines can present obstacles to fully implementing interdisciplinary education. It also requires sufficient institutional support to provide the necessary resources and professional development for teachers.
## Examples of Interdisciplinary Curricula in Education
Applications of interdisciplinary education are widespread in educational institutions around the world. For example, curricula such as “STEM” (Science, Technology, Engineering, Mathematics) are used in many schools, where these areas are integrated to encourage students to innovate and think critically. Another example is “Global Perspectives,” which connects social, scientific, and literary subjects through the study of diverse issues like migration and climate change. In the arts, curricula extend to incorporate arts with sciences, providing students with an expanded learning experience that enhances creative thinking.

## Ways to Activate Interdisciplinary Education in Schools
To activate interdisciplinary education in schools, a set of strategic steps can be followed. First, schools should establish a clear vision that embraces interdisciplinarity as a fundamental part of their educational philosophy. Second, there should be ongoing training for teachers to equip them with the tools necessary to implement interactive curricula. Third, flexible learning environments should be created that promote collaboration among students, such as cooperative learning and group projects. Finally, schools should establish partnerships with the local community and external entities, allowing students to apply what they have learned in real contexts and strengthening their connections with the outside world.
## Examples of Interdisciplinary Educational Projects
The principles of interdisciplinary education can be illustrated through a set of innovative educational projects. For example, an agricultural project where students from multiple disciplines such as environmental science, engineering, and art collaborate to produce a sustainable school garden. Students learn about environmental factors and engineering techniques, and at the same time, they can utilize their artistic skills to design aesthetic spaces. Another project could focus on designing a campaign to raise awareness about the importance of water, where subjects such as science, history, and language collaborate to produce rich and multifaceted content, making students engage with a real global issue.

##
Global Examples of Interdisciplinary Education
Many global models demonstrate the success of interdisciplinary education in developing students’ skills. In Finland, the education system relies on integrating subjects in a way that enhances meaningful learning and connects it to students’ daily lives. In the United States, project-based methodologies are used in many schools, engaging students in real community issues. Additionally, in countries like Japan, educational methods focusing on collaboration between subjects are employed, helping students achieve a deeper understanding and differentiation between various concepts. These models are considered ideal examples of educational experiences that encourage creativity and real-life learning.
